Output 58e082d3014b4fb5b5a9434ba0f559bd7c90d764477d5d3faf9a1492a3ea5650:3

value
36582855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4986da19944baeb824deb9d19430120c76907c54 OP_EQUAL
address
MEbw77SBg9cWFvCDbe1fHZEAd1wKqZ367m
transaction
58e082d3014b4fb5b5a9434ba0f559bd7c90d764477d5d3faf9a1492a3ea5650
spent
true